Chris Grainger wins Rd3 of BRCA TC series

Round three of this seasons BRCA National touring car championship saw victory for Schumacher’s Chris Grainger ahead of Colin Price and Andy Moore, the event proved to be one of the most intriguing for many seasons. Halifax is renowned for being quick on new tyres and tyre strategy proved to be the big talking point at the head of the field, while Chris Grainger and Tamiya’s Elliott Harper slogged it out fighting for TQ other drivers including Andy Moore and Olly Jefferies were saving their fresh rubber and attempting to qualify on just one set.

Toennessen wins Rd3 of Western German Champs

Mugen racer Daniel Toennessen was walking on water on his way to winning round three of the Western German Championship in the 1/10 scale nitro on-road class at Velp. Toennessen became the third winner in the third race with René Puepke winning round one at Dormagen and Michael Salven winning at Dueren. Bernd Rausch has been the main challenger at every race but is still waiting for his first victory. Nevertheless, the Kyosho hotshot is leading the championship ranking.

Armin Baier wins Rd5 in Southern Germany

Last weekend the MCC Türkheim hosted the 5th round of the Southern German Championship. Although the weather forecast didn’t look too good, the actual weather was great throughout the entire weekend. In class 1 Christoph Pietsch, Robert’s uncle, took TQ with his OS powered Mugen while second place went to Armin Baier, running a Picco powered Motonica P81RS2 and third was Shepherd / Sonic driver Maximilian Vogl. In class 2 Ralf Drachsler, Mugen / RB took the top spot in front of Maximilian Günther, Motonica P81RS2 / Picco and Alexander Bremberger.

Double victory & title for Coelho in Portugal Rd4

Last weekend saw the 4th round of the Portuguese gas on road nationals at the Vila Real circuit where this year’s 1/8th scale European Championships will be held at the start of next month. The race saw Mugen Novarossi driver Bruno Coelho TQ and win both the 1/8th and 1/10th scale 200mm classes as well as retain both his national titles. The track was very abrasive and the tires could only last ten minutes, so Bruno had to drive very carefully and conserve tires in a race of tactics rather than out and out performance. The 1/8th scale main saw Coelho take the win by 2 laps ahead of Jose Pequito in 2nd and Jose Carlos in 3rd. In the 1/10th scale class the margin of victory for Bruno was 4 laps ahead of Mário Miranda in 2nd and Hugo Mendes in 3rd.

Kevin Pignotti wins Race2theWorlds contest

Kevin Pignotti from Italy has won the first Race2theWorlds contest. With over 1000 racers and gamers involved in this contest, the R2tW has become the single biggest R/C event ever. Kevin Pignotti is now preparing himself for to collect his big prize, the ultimate once-in-a-lifetime opportunity: to join the IFMAR 2012 World Championship Electrics 1:10 in the Netherlands on the 25th of July. The 16 year old said ‘it’s like a dream coming true’ and he hopes to do well at the 2012 IFMAR Worlds. For sure, it is going to be very interesting to see how well this young talent (without any prior experience in electric racing) is going to perform on World class level amidst the best of the best in R/C racing.

Patrick Schäfer wins Rd4 in middle Germany

Last weekend the 4th round of the Middle German Championship took place in Kastellaun in the midwest of Germany. In total 22 drivers in different classes attended this event to score points for the championship. In the 1/10th class Patrick Schäfer had a great weekend with his Sonic powered Velox V10 “twelve” testing a new chassis and radio plate with a new battery mount for a standard 5-cell battery pack. After the first qualification heat on Saturday evening he was Top Qualifier 11 seconds in front of second placed Hartmut Rose. On Sunday morning it began to rain and there were no more try qualification heats. For the finals it stopped to rain and the track dried completely. Patrick Schäfer won the race in front of Hartmut Rose and Shepherd driver Sascha Vorgrümler in 3rd position.

Mark Green wins Rd5 of BRCA 200mm series

The 5th round of the British 200mm championship was held at the excellent Cotswold circuit. The forecast for the weekend looked really bad with heavy rain predicted for both Saturday and Sunday. Current championship leader Mark Green faced some tougher competition at the front this meeting with the returning Kyle Branson looking very quick during practice. Much of Saturday’s practice was spent testing damp/rubber tyres under the wet conditions. Around 1 hour from the 6pm finish time the track was almost completely dry which caused a big rush of drivers trying to get out on track. They actually had to queue up for a space on the rostrum as everybody tried to make the most of the remaining time.
